Product Details
| Property | Value |
|---|---|
| Construction - Pair Assembly | Two insulated conductors twisted with a flexible strand, tin-coated copper drain wire, a helically applied aluminum/polyester laminated tape shield and an isolation tape |
| Construction - Jacket | Hypalon heavy-duty chlorosulfonated polyethylene (HD-CSPE) colors to ANSI standard by type |
| Construction - Insulation | Proprietary heat, moisture and radiation resistant flame retardant crosslinked polyethylene |
| Construction - Fillers | As applicable |
| Construction - Conductor | Solid alloys per ANSI MC 96.1 (Extension Grade, standard limits of error) |
| Construction - Cabling | Required number of pairs cabled together |
| Construction - Binder Tape | Helically applied polyester |
| Construction - Circuit Identification | Individual pair single conductors color coded to ANSI requirements by means of pigmented insulation with printed pair numbers on both singles for pair identification |
| UL Listings | UL 1277 • 90°C wet & dry locations • UL VW-1 |
| Product Category | Thermocouple |
| Performance Standards | Insulation ICEA S-66-524 • Jackets ICEA S-19-81 for Hypalon (CSPE) • Class 1E qualified IEEE 383-1974 and IEEE 323-1974 • IEEE 383-1974 70,000 BTU flame test as modified by NRC Reg. Guide 1.131 • ICEA T-29-520 210,000 BTU • IEEE 383-1974 para. 2.5.6 (ICEA S-19-81 Section 6.19.6) • ANSI standard MC 96.1 • 10 CFR 50 Appendix B • 40 CFR, Part 261 |
| Volts | 600 |
| Applications | Harsh Environment Power Control Instrumentation |
| Market Served | Nuclear |
| Temperature | 90ºC |
